Woodrising vs Booragul.
Comparing two suburbs with median house prices of $790,000 and $855,000.
Woodrising (median $790,000) is roughly 8% cheaper to buy into than Booragul ($855,000). Over the past year, Booragul (+11.9%) ran 6.6 percentage points ahead of Woodrising (+5.3%) on house-price growth.
Booragul scores higher on walkability (0/100 vs 2/100 ), useful if you're optimising for a car-light household. On school quality, the average ICSEA across schools serving Woodrising (987) sits above Booragul (980). Woodrising skews owner-occupied (81%), Booragul runs more rental-dense (54% owner).

For investors
Investors face a yield-versus-growth split: Woodrising delivers the better gross yield (4.94% vs 4.56%), but Booragul has run faster on capital growth this year. The right pick depends on whether you're optimising for cash flow or capital appreciation.

Does Woodrising or Booragul have better schools?
On average school ICSEA (the ACARA index that benchmarks educational advantage), Woodrising scores 987 vs 980 in Booragul. ICSEA is a school-community indicator, not a quality rating, so always check NAPLAN results and catchment boundaries for the specific address you're considering.

Which suburb has higher rental yield, Woodrising or Booragul?
Gross rental yield on houses is 4.94% in Woodrising vs 4.56% in Booragul. Gross yield equals annual rent divided by purchase price. Net yield (after strata, rates, insurance, agent fees and maintenance) typically runs 1.5-2 percentage points lower.
